In the process of downloading my e-mail this evening, my virus firewall flagged a message as having a viral attachment. The attachment is called "WELDATA.EXE". Please be aware and don't open this file. I deleted the file immediately without opening it and as such cannot tell you what merryment it will cause.

Smart idea. Lately, I am getting an *.exe file a day flagged as a virus. It has gotten so bad that I am not routing anything but mail and *.jpg files into my inbox. The rest get filtered out before i see them. Never open an *.exe file arriving in the mail unless you are certain about it's origin. Same holds true with visual basic files and other suffix's. More and more it seems that you can't really trust anything not already known to you, so be careful.
